imf4ll/moo

Playslist não carrega [LINUX]

Closed this issue · 8 comments

Estou tentando abrir uma playlist mas não tá rolando, mesmo tendo atualizado pra versão v0.1.4-rc2.

Peek 2023-07-20 15-51

imf4ll commented

pelo backend não tá rolando nem a requisição, provavelmente má formação do objeto quando foi salvo no local storage

pelo backend não tá rolando nem a requisição, provavelmente má formação do objeto quando foi salvo no local storage

A saída:

Overriding existing handler for signal 10. Set JSC_SIGNAL_FOR_GC if you want WebKit to use a different signal
[GIN-debug] [WARNING] Creating an Engine instance with the Logger and Recovery middleware already attached.

[GIN-debug] [WARNING] Running in "debug" mode. Switch to "release" mode in production.
 - using env:	export GIN_MODE=release
 - using code:	gin.SetMode(gin.ReleaseMode)

[GIN-debug] GET    /search                   --> github.com/imf4ll/moo/backend/controllers.SearchController (4 handlers)
[GIN-debug] GET    /download                 --> github.com/imf4ll/moo/backend/controllers.DownloadController (4 handlers)
[GIN-debug] GET    /downloads                --> github.com/imf4ll/moo/backend/controllers.DownloadsController (4 handlers)
[GIN-debug] GET    /files                    --> github.com/imf4ll/moo/backend/controllers.ServeController (4 handlers)
[GIN-debug] GET    /sync                     --> github.com/imf4ll/moo/backend/controllers.PlaylistController (4 handlers)
[GIN-debug] GET    /playlist                 --> github.com/imf4ll/moo/backend/controllers.PlaylistController (5 handlers)
[GIN-debug] GET    /audio                    --> github.com/imf4ll/moo/backend/controllers.GetAudioController (5 handlers)
[GIN-debug] GET    /artist                   --> github.com/imf4ll/moo/backend/controllers.ArtistController (5 handlers)
[GIN-debug] [WARNING] You trusted all proxies, this is NOT safe. We recommend you to set a value.
Please check https://pkg.go.dev/github.com/gin-gonic/gin#readme-don-t-trust-all-proxies for details.
[GIN-debug] Listening and serving HTTP on :3001
[GIN] 2023/07/20 - 15:55:46 | 200 |     678.875µs |             ::1 | GET      "/audio?id=n4tK7LYFxI0"
[GIN] 2023/07/20 - 15:55:47 | 400 |     329.928µs |             ::1 | GET      "/playlist?id=undefined"

Essa é uma playlist que adicionei antes da atualização. O mesmo acontece com essa outra aqui, só que outro erro:

Peek 2023-07-20 15-57

imf4ll commented

como eu desconfiei, tá undefined pq a playlist foi mal formada antes de ir pro local storage, vc salvou como, foi na barra de pesquisa e favoritou ou adicionou manualmente?

como eu desconfiei, tá undefined pq a playlist foi mal formada antes de ir pro local storage, vc salvou como, foi na barra de pesquisa e favoritou ou adicionou manualmente?

Eu adicionei manualmente no botão de +

Eu não sei de usar "corretamente" o GitHub, pra criar sugestões o certo seria abrir um um pull request, né? Pois seria bom poder apagá-las.

imf4ll commented

Os pull requests não apagam tbm, vc tá usando o lugar certo, pull request é pra enviar uma implementação, issues são pra discutir, reportar bugs, etc

imf4ll commented

Eu vou tentar reproduzir alguma má formação de playlist pra ver se é problema no código ou erro por parte do webscrapping que as vezes falha e não tem oq fazer

Eu até pensei em tentar apagar ou modificar algo em ~/.local/share/moo-linux-amd64, mas são arquivos de banco de dados que não dão pra alterar 😅 ou pelo menos eu não sei como.

imf4ll commented

Fiquei curioso agora, no meu não tem isso aí não